About

Susan Rae Patterson is a civil rights attorney with more than 30 years of legal experience, practicing at Susan R. Patterson in Dallas, TX. She earned a B.A. from Bethel College (Mishawaka) in 1969 and a J.D. from Southern Methodist University, Dedman School of Law in 1994. She has been admitted to the Texas Bar since 1996. Her practice encompasses civil rights, elder law, family, and probate, allowing her to serve clients across a range of legal needs. She ma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
